app开发去哪学习

hboxs 48分钟前 阅读数 405 #APP开发
文章标签 app开发学习
微信号:hboxs7
添加项目经理微信 获取更多优惠
复制微信号

学习APP开发的最佳途径

在当今数字化时代,APP开发已成为一项热门技能,吸引了众多初学者和专业人士的关注。如果你想学习APP开发,以下是一些推荐的学习资源和途径:

  1. 在线学习平台

    • Udacity:提供丰富的移动开发课程,包括Android和iOS开发,适合初学者和进阶学习者。
    • Coursera:与多所大学合作,提供APP开发相关的课程,涵盖从基础到高级的内容。
    • edX:提供来自知名大学的在线课程,学习内容包括编程语言、移动开发框架等。
  2. 官方开发者网站

    • Apple Developer:苹果官方提供的资源,涵盖iOS开发的所有方面,包括Swift语言和Xcode工具的使用。
    • Android Developers:谷歌官方的Android开发者网站,提供详细的文档、教程和示例代码,适合学习Android开发的初学者。
  3. 编程学习网站

    • Codecademy:提供互动式编程课程,适合初学者学习编程基础。
    • FreeCodeCamp:一个非营利组织,提供全面的免费编程课程,帮助学习者掌握网页开发和计算机科学基础。
  4. 开发者社区

    • Stack Overflow:一个知名的编程问答网站,开发者可以在这里提问和回答问题,获取大量的实用信息。
    • GitHub:代码托管平台,开发者可以找到许多开源项目,学习他人的代码和项目经验。

APP开发学习的深入扩展

学习路径

学习APP开发通常可以分为几个阶段:

  1. 基础知识学习

    • 在开始之前,了解计算机科学的基础知识、编程语言的基本概念是非常重要的。选择一门主流的编程语言,如Java(Android)或Swift(iOS),并掌握其语法和特性。
  2. 开发环境和工具

    • 熟悉开发环境是成功开发APP的关键。对于iOS开发,学习使用Xcode;对于Android开发,学习使用Android Studio。这些工具提供了代码编辑、调试和性能监测等功能。
  3. 移动开发框架

    • 学习常用的移动开发框架和工具,如React Native和Flutter,这些框架支持跨平台开发,可以用相同的代码构建Android和iOS应用。
  4. 实践项目

    • 理论知识的学习需要通过实践来巩固。选择一个小型项目进行开发,比如待办事项应用,能够帮助你将所学知识应用于实际。

用户体验设计

在APP开发中,用户体验(UX)设计至关重要。开发者需要理解用户的需求,设计直观且易于使用的界面。学习基本的UI设计原则和工具(如Sketch或Adobe XD)将有助于提升你的设计能力。

深入学习与持续更新

APP开发是一个快速发展的领域,技术和工具不断更新。开发者需要保持学习的态度,关注行业动态,参加开发者社区和活动,与其他开发者交流经验。

资源推荐

  • 书籍:阅读相关书籍,如《Android Programming: The Big Nerd Ranch Guide》和《iOS Programming: The Big Nerd Ranch Guide》,可以帮助你深入理解开发原理和技巧。

  • 视频教程:YouTube上有许多免费的APP开发教程,适合视觉学习者。

  • 在线论坛:加入开发者论坛,如Reddit的r/learnprogramming,可以与其他学习者交流,获取建议和资源。

结论

学习APP开发的途径多种多样,从在线课程到官方文档,再到开发者社区,初学者可以根据自己的需求和学习风格选择合适的资源。通过系统的学习和实践,任何人都可以掌握APP开发的技能,创造出属于自己的应用程序。坚持学习和实践是成为优秀开发者的关键。

版权声明

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!

热门